In order for a project manager to be successful there are many aspects of the organization that must be
considered. These aspects include the organizational culture, management style and techniques, process maturity involved,
and the organizations structure towards aligning corporate goals with project goals. (Colorado Technical University Online,
2010)


                    Corporate culture can have devastating effects on the success or failure of a project. This practices around
staffing, rewards and recognition programs, leadership and employee skill development, attitude, work and life balance, and
underling values and code of conducts. In order for a project to succeed all stakeholders (leadership, managers, project
members, customers) must understand contribute towards the projects success. There must be reward and recognition
programs in place to motivate and inspire management and employees, and leadership must provide the project manager with
the tools and supreme authority on all project resources. The project manager must also have a good relationship with the line
manager to ensure productive utilization of man power. (Colorado Technical University Online, 2010)


                     Management styles which effect project management success or failure involves the decision making,
information sharing, team building, and governance. The project manager is assigned as the sole responsibility for a projects
success and all barriers preventing that success must be eliminated if a project is to succeed. This includes management and
leadership that like to micromanage projects and resources. (Colorado Technical University Online, 2010)


                    The corporations project maturity is also a deciding factor in determining a projects success. Project
maturity involves the attitudes towards using accepted PM practices, number and types of processes, adherence to
procedures, and amount of process improvement undertaken. Corporations new to project management will have a harder
time benefiting from and utilizing project management than those that are use to the practice. The project manager and
project team make all the difference here.


                    Organizational structure also plays a huge role in a projects success. This will be discussed further on the
next slide. (Colorado Technical University Online, 2010)


                   A project manager has the greatest amount of organizational support when: work in the corporation is
focused on projects, the organization has used and recognizes the importance of project management, the organization
follows and rewards standard practices in managing projects. (Colorado Technical University Online, 2010)

The three types of corporate structures that should be considered for effective utilization of
project management are functional, project based, and matrix structures. (Colorado Technical University Online,
2010)

                  The functional structure is the most traditional type of organizational structure. In the functional
structure every employee has one defined boss. Departments are function based, such as marketing, technology,
customer support, finance, engineering, information technology, and production. There is often a unique,
structured hierarchy and projects are usually limited and focused inside each department. Communication
between departments is often strained and cross developmental projects are extremely rare. This type of
organization can be the hardest for project managers involved in cross departmental projects and involves the
greatest communication and participation. This is the type of structure at HLR, Inc. (Colorado Technical
University Online, 2010)

                  Project based organizational structures are the easiest for successful project management.
These types of organizations are founded upon project management principles. Employees may have a home
department but work is always project based. Employees in departments are often grouped into functional
project based groups designed to provide max efficiency and communication. This type of organization is very
common for software companies. (Colorado Technical University Online, 2010)

                  Matrix based organizations are a mix between project based and functional based. People are
assigned two or more bosses and annual reviews and rewards are based upon their performance assigned these
through multiple bosses. Communication and consensus are imperative in this type of organizational structure. A
project managers influence is highly dependant up the authority and control given to him over corporate
resources. (Colorado Technical University Online, 2010)

                  Some organizational impacts on project management include: the influence the project manager
has to successfully complete a project and maximize a projects utilization of corporate resources, the ability for a
project manager to select and motivate the project management team, the ability for the project manager to
communicate with stakeholders, department heads, customers, and team members, and the project managers
decision making capability. (Colorado Technical University Online, 2010)

As I made mention in last weeks meeting, The PMBOK defines a project manager as “The person assigned by the performing organization
to achieve the project objectives” (A Guide to, 2008, pg. 444)

                          Remember, the project manager is the ultimate person responsible for the successful completion of a project within specified quality
performance requirements, time and schedule constraints, scope and budget constraints, and so that the end customer is satisfied. The project manager is also
the leader of the project management team and is responsible for managing the efforts and performance of the team.

                           The PMBOK specifies that project managers should be knowledgeable about project management (a wide grasp of the areas involved in
the project is also a useful aid), be consistently high performers, and have the ability to guide the project team while achieving project objectives. (A Guide to,
2008, pg. 13).

                          As the person responsible for the success of the project, the project manager is given sole responsibility and control of all aspects of the
project including creating the project management plan and related plans, ensuring the project stays on track (within schedule and budget), identifying,
monitoring, and responding to risk, and generating correct and timely reporting of metrics. (A Guide to, 2008, pg. 26)

                         Successful project managers utilize several useful techniques in order to deal with their often dual responsibilities and ensure project
success. Some of these techniques include, understanding the role of the stakeholders while effectively communicating and influencing the stakeholders in order
to maintain project support, strategic planning followed by efficient and decisive actions, managing the project rather than becoming managed by the project, and
keeping their eyes focused on the finish line.

                      The project manager has several roles and responsibilities. Some of the project managers roles include the role of a planner,
communicator, implementer, integrator, evaluator, manager, and leader.

                        The integrator role of a project manager includes the requirement that the project manager can integrate necessary activities needed to
develop, execute, and adapt the project plan. (Kerzner, 2009, pg. 12)

                           The role of a good communicator is essential for any project manager and demand that the project manager maintains an interpersonal
role, informational role, and decisional role.

                          The project managers interpersonal means that the project manager must be an honest, capable, dependable, personable and effective
leader. The project manager is responsible for dealing successfully with people from diverse backgrounds and experiences, developing an environment of team
unity, resolving team disagreements, focusing team members towards milestones, motivating team members toward reaching goals, and constructing positive
relationships with stakeholders and the project team members.

                          The project managers informational role requires that the project manager be able to coordinate and lead team meetings, provide
critical feedback on project results, phases, problems encountered, and quality of deliverables.

                         The project managers informational role requires that the project manager be proficient at using his expertise to make sound judgments
without alienating others through the decisions made.

                          Finally the white page Competencies for Project Managers (Wourms, 2002) states that project manager should also be motivators, good
communicators, be able to talk the talk, understand and follow standard project management methodology, be able to coach the project team, and have an
active, wide and diverse grasp of technological understanding (essential for IT project managers). (Wourms, 2002)
